Box 2009 • (1601 East Hazelton Avenue) • Stockton, California 95201 <br />(209) 468-3400 <br />SEP 6 1991 <br />DAMES AND MOORE <br />8801 FOLSOM BLVD #200 <br />SACRAMENTO CA 95826 <br />RE: Delta Bulk Terminal <br />Phase II Site Investigation <br />Port of Stockton <br />2201 W. Washington <br />Stockton, CA <br />IN REPLY REFER TO SITE CODE: 9227 <br />On August 15, 1991, a permit to hand auger and install monitoring wells was issued to Water Development <br />Corp. of Woodland for work at this site. <br />San Joaquin County Public Health Services, Environmental Health Division (PHS/EHD) required 48 hour <br />confirmed notice for drilling activities including hand augering. Mr. Kevin Brown was informed of this <br />requirement when he was in our office here in Stockton. Monitoring well construction started on August <br />19, 1991, and the scheduling of this activity was confirmed by Michael Infunia of our staff. The hand <br />augering started on August 15, 1991, according to Kevin Brown. Our office was not notified of this activity <br />and the grouting was not inspected by our staff. Also, the hand augered holes were refilled with the same <br />soil and not grouted with neat cement or bentonite as is required on sites where contamination is suspected. <br />Hand augering for the purpose of gathering subsurface information is a permitted activity and is subject to <br />the drilling and grouting requirements enforced by PHS/EHD. <br />We bring this to your attention in hopes of avoiding future occurrences of unauthorized drilling (including <br />hand augering) and grouting that would result in an office hearing. <br />If you have any questions, contact Michael Infurna, FtEHS, of my staff at (209)468-3454. <br />c: Water Development Corp. <br />1202 Kentucky Ave., Woodland, CA 95695 <br />A Division of San Joaquin County Health Care Services ()
